U.S. Mission to India: World Affairs in Theory and Practice

Deadline: 23 June 2019

The Regional Public Engagement Specialist (REPS) Office of the U.S. Embassy’s Public Affairs Section is seeking proposals for a program entitled “World Affairs in Theory and Practice”.

Implemented at the New Delhi American Center (NDAC), this competitive program will draw from a target audience of high-achieving undergraduate-level students connected to academic programs in the fields of international affairs, sustainable development, human rights, health policy business, and related disciplines.

The objective of the program is to offer to our target audience of youth leaders three facilitated MOOCs (Massive, Open, Online Courses) on themes of foreign policy importance; provide the opportunity for these leaders to apply their knowledge through “real-world” decision-making on policy matters through diplomacy simulations; and expose them to higher education opportunities in the United States.

Participants will complete one of three MOOCs (Massive, Open, Online Courses) on themes of global health, environmental security, and international trade offered by American universities and expertly facilitated at the NDAC.  Courses will meet weekly and will last 4-6 weeks, depending on the format of each MOOC selected for the series.  Following the completion of each MOOC course, participants will participate in a live simulation of diplomatic negotiations around a similar theme as their course, helping them understand complex issues in theory and practice.  Finally, participants will be introduced to EducationUSA advisors from the U.S. India Educational Foundation (USIEF) for counseling on options for pursuing higher education in the United States.
